§ 137.72 Are Self-Governance Tribes and their employees carrying out statutorily mandated grant programs added to a funding agreement covered by the Federal Tort Claims Act (FTCA)? Yes, Self-Governance Tribes and their employees carrying out statutorily mandated grant programs are added to a funding agreement covered by the FTCA. Regulations governing coverage under the FTCA are published at 25 CFR Part 900, Subpart M.
